About

Fully Loaded Backend for Angular Apps

Backand provides an all-inclusive backend-as-a-service platform that enables developers to build and run scalable, complete serverless applications with AWS Lambda, simplifying the implementation of microservices architecture. The companys multiservice infrastructure also offers security as a service (SECaaS), integration as a service (IaaS) and database as a service (DBaaS), adding powerful capabilities to users web and mobile applications, including social login, security, user management, hosting, a database API, Ionic support, push notifications, and pre-integrated third-party services. Backand eliminates the need for developers to set up or maintain infrastructure, allowing for faster app creation without the backend hassles.
